Using the Start/Stop Button to Clear the Track

If a document or documents stop in the track during processing, hold down
the Start/Stop button for several seconds. This action starts the track motor
and normally ejects documents into a pocket for reprocessing.
When a jam occurs, it may be necessary to take other actions to clear the
track. Refer to "Clearing the Track," in Section 6.

Status Lights

Three lights on the front of the unit (Figure 3-4) indicate the status of the unit
and the application that runs on the host PC. Some applications add audible
messages to indicate status.
The sequence of lights you normally see when powering on the Source NDP
unit is described in "Powering the Unit On and Off," earlier in this section.
During normal operation, the Ready light remains solid green while
documents are flowing. It blinks green if documents stop, which may
occur if the application is slow in processing information or if the network is
slow. It may also blink green if the Source NDP unit is capturing OCR as well
as MICR data because the application is stopping and quickly restarting
documents in the track loop area.
